Important SUSE Security Patch for java-11-openjdk addresses 7 vulnerabilities. Ensure your systems are updated with the latest fixes.
An update that fixes 7 vulnerabilities is now available

Summary

This update for java-11-openjdk fixes the following issues: Update to version jdk-11.0.6-10 (January 2020 CPU, bsc#1160968) Fixing these security related issues: - CVE-2020-2583: Unlink Set of LinkedHashSets - CVE-2020-2590: Improve Kerberos interop capabilities - CVE-2020-2593: Normalize normalization for all - CVE-2020-2601: Better Ticket Granting Services - CVE-2020-2604: Better serial filter handling - CVE-2020-2655: Better TLS messaging support - CVE-2020-2654: Improve Object Identifier Processing Patch Instructions: To install this SU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ch". Alternatively you can run the command listed for your product: - SUSE Linux Enterprise Server for SAP 15:
